Understanding Grapefruit Essential Oil

Grapefruit essential oil is extracted from the peel of the grapefruit, primarily through a process called cold pressing. This method helps to retain the beneficial compounds present in the fruit’s rind, resulting in a potent and fragrant oil. The oil’s chemical composition includes compounds like limonene, myrcene, and alpha-pinene, which contribute to its unique properties.

Limonene, a major component, is known for its uplifting and mood-boosting effects. Myrcene is often associated with relaxing qualities, while alpha-pinene has been linked to improved focus and alertness. The synergistic interaction of these compounds contributes to the oil’s overall effectiveness.

The quality of grapefruit essential oil can vary depending on factors like the origin of the fruit, the extraction method, and storage conditions. Always choose 100% pure, therapeutic-grade essential oil from a reputable source to ensure you’re getting the maximum benefits.

Safety Precautions

While grapefruit essential oil is generally safe for use, it’s essential to take certain precautions to avoid any adverse reactions.

  • Dilution is key: Always dilute grapefruit essential oil with a carrier oil before applying it to your skin. A general guideline is to use a 1-3% dilution, which means adding 1-3 drops of essential oil per teaspoon of carrier oil.
  • Patch test: Before using grapefruit essential oil on a large area of your skin, perform a patch test on a small, inconspicuous area to check for any allergic reactions or sensitivities.
  • Sun sensitivity: Grapefruit essential oil can increase your skin’s sensitivity to the sun. Avoid direct sun exposure for at least 12 hours after applying grapefruit essential oil to your skin. If sun exposure is unavoidable, wear protective clothing and apply sunscreen with a high SPF.
  • Pregnancy and breastfeeding: If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, consult with a healthcare professional before using grapefruit essential oil.
  • Children and pets: Use caution when using grapefruit essential oil around children and pets. Keep essential oils out of reach of children and pets, and always dilute them properly before using them around them.
  • Internal use: Do not ingest grapefruit essential oil unless under the guidance of a qualified healthcare professional or certified aromatherapist. Not all essential oils are safe for internal use, and improper use can be harmful.
  • Storage: Store grapefruit essential oil in a cool, dark place away from direct sunlight and heat. This will help to preserve its quality and potency.

Is grapefruit essential oil safe to apply directly to the skin?

Generally, grapefruit essential oil should not be applied directly to the skin undiluted. Its potent nature can cause skin irritation, sensitivity, and even phototoxicity, especially when exposed to sunlight. Always dilute grapefruit essential oil with a carrier oil, such as jojoba, coconut, or almond oil, before applying it topically. A general guideline is to use a 1-3% dilution ratio, meaning 1-3 drops of essential oil per teaspoon of carrier oil.

However, even when diluted, it’s crucial to perform a patch test on a small, inconspicuous area of skin before applying it more widely. Wait 24-48 hours to observe any adverse reactions such as redness, itching, or swelling. If any irritation occurs, discontinue use immediately. Additionally, avoid direct sunlight exposure for at least 12 hours after topical application due to its phototoxic properties.

What are the best carrier oils to use with grapefruit essential oil?

Selecting the right carrier oil is essential for maximizing the benefits of grapefruit essential oil while minimizing the risk of skin irritation. Jojoba oil is a popular choice due to its similarity to the skin’s natural sebum, making it easily absorbed and suitable for most skin types. It’s also non-comedogenic, meaning it won’t clog pores, making it a good option for acne-prone skin.

Another excellent choice is sweet almond oil, known for its moisturizing and nourishing properties. It’s rich in vitamins and antioxidants, which help to protect and rejuvenate the skin. Coconut oil, particularly fractionated coconut oil, is also widely used due to its light texture and ability to easily penetrate the skin. However, it’s important to note that coconut oil can be comedogenic for some individuals, so it’s best to test it on a small area first.

Can grapefruit essential oil interact with medications?

Yes, grapefruit essential oil can interact with certain medications, similar to how grapefruit juice can affect their absorption and metabolism. This interaction primarily occurs because grapefruit essential oil contains compounds that can inhibit cytochrome P450 enzymes, which are responsible for breaking down many drugs in the liver. This can lead to increased levels of the medication in the bloodstream, potentially causing adverse effects or toxicity.

It’s crucial to consult with your doctor or pharmacist before using grapefruit essential oil if you are taking any prescription medications. Pay particular attention if you are taking medications for heart conditions, high cholesterol, anxiety, depression, or blood thinning, as these are known to be commonly affected by grapefruit interactions. Being proactive and informed can help prevent potential complications and ensure your safety.

How should grapefruit essential oil be stored to maintain its potency?

Proper storage is vital to preserve the quality and potency of grapefruit essential oil. The key factors that can degrade essential oils are light, heat, and oxygen. Therefore, the ideal storage environment is a cool, dark, and airtight container. Amber or dark blue glass bottles are preferred, as they help to protect the oil from harmful UV rays that can break down its chemical components.

Avoid storing grapefruit essential oil in areas with fluctuating temperatures, such as near a window or a heat source. A stable temperature is crucial for maintaining its integrity. Always ensure the bottle is tightly sealed after each use to minimize exposure to oxygen, which can cause oxidation and diminish the oil’s therapeutic properties. When stored correctly, grapefruit essential oil can maintain its potency for approximately 1-2 years.

What are some potential side effects of using grapefruit essential oil?

While generally considered safe when used properly, grapefruit essential oil can cause side effects in some individuals. Skin irritation is a common concern, especially if the oil is applied undiluted or at too high of a concentration. This can manifest as redness, itching, burning, or even a rash. It’s essential to perform a patch test before widespread application to minimize this risk.

Another significant side effect is phototoxicity, meaning the oil can increase the skin’s sensitivity to sunlight, leading to sunburn or skin discoloration. Therefore, it’s crucial to avoid direct sunlight exposure for at least 12 hours after applying grapefruit essential oil topically. Additionally, pregnant or breastfeeding women and individuals with certain medical conditions should consult with a healthcare professional before using grapefruit essential oil to ensure it is safe for them.
